It's because not all Open Beta servers are using the same release that you have.
Players have to have the same version of ESF as the server has. (exactly same client.dll file)

Your version of Open Beta is old now, but most servers are even older.
(to make this easier, I'll copy and paste my list thing)

R1 - 5th Jan 07 --- no patch for ESF B1.2.3 -> ESF B1.3 OB-R1
R2 -20th Jan 07 --- 1st patch (R1 -> R2)
R3 - 4th Feb 07 --- 2nd patch (R2 -> R3)
R4 -18th Feb 07 --- 3rd patch (R3 -> R4)
R5 -18th Mar 07 --- 4th patch (R4 -> R5)
R6 - 9th Apr 07 --- 5th patch (R5 -> R6)


Newest version is R6.
You have R5.

The current two main dedicated Open Beta servers...
- .Maze's ESF 1.3 OB Server uses R4. (.Maze said he's changing this server to normal ESF B1.2.3)
- ESF 1.3 Testing Grounds uses R4.
